What is Horsepower-hour to Electron-volt Conversion?
Horsepower-hour (hp⋅h) and electron-volt (eV) are both units used to measure energy, but they serve different purposes depending on the scale of the measurement. If you ever need to convert horsepower-hour to electron-volt, knowing the exact conversion formula is essential.
Hp⋅h to ev Conversion Formula:
One Horsepower-hour is equal to 1.675761e+25 Electron-volt.
Formula: 1 hp⋅h = 1.675761e+25 eV
By using this conversion factor, you can easily convert any energy from horsepower-hour to electron-volt with precision.
